#f1cc78 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f1cc78 is composed of 94.5% red, 80%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 15.4% magenta, 50.2%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 41.7 degrees, a saturation of 81.2% and a lightness of 70.8%. #f1cc78 color hex could be obtained by blending #fffff0 with #e39900. Closest websafe color is: #ffcc66.

Shades and Tints of #f1cc78

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070501 is the darkest color, while #fefbf4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#f1cc78

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b8b6b1 is the less saturated color, while #fcd06d is the most saturated one.
